Q:

The most abundant gas in the atmosphere is

A) Nitrogen B) Argon
C) Oxygen D) Helium
 
Answer & Explanation Answer: A) Nitrogen

Explanation:

The atmosphere is a mixture of several gases. Nitrogen is the most abundant gas in the atmoshere and oxygen is next to it. It is 78% in the atmosphere and 21% is oxygen. Remaining 1% is all other gases like argon, hydrogen, neon, etc...

Q:

In how many different ways can the letters of the word 'RITUAL' be arranged?

A) 720 B) 5040
C) 360 D) 180
 
Answer & Explanation Answer: A) 720

Explanation:

The number of letters in the given word RITUAL = 6

Then, 

Required number of different ways can the letters of the word 'RITUAL' be arranged = 6!

=> 6 x 5 x 4 x 3 x 2 x 1 = 720

Q:

In plants, chloroplasts are necessary for 

A) photosynthesis B) storage
C) cell movement D) respiration
 
Answer & Explanation Answer: A) photosynthesis

Explanation:

Plants are producers, which means they make their own food. Chloroplasts are organelles found in eukaryotic and plant cells that conduct photosynthesis. Chloroplasts absorb sunlight and use it in conjunction with water and carbon dioxide gas to produce food for the plant.

Plants use energy from sunlight to help make their food, but they need chloroplasts to do it.

 

Hence, in plants, chloroplasts are necessary for Photosynthesis.
